### Course Overview
The IBM Business Intelligence (BI) Analyst course covers a wide range of topics essential for anyone looking to excel in BI. The curriculum includes:

1. **Business Intelligence (BI) Essentials**: A comprehensive introduction to BI, its key concepts, components, and benefits.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/business-intelligence-essentials)

2. **Excel Basics for Data Analysis**: Master the essential spreadsheet tools like Excel, which are crucial for data analytics and business.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/excel-basics-data-analysis-ibm)

3. **Data Visualization and Dashboards with Excel and Cognos**: Learn to create impactful data visualizations and dashboards.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/data-visualization-dashboards-excel-cognos)

4. **Introduction to Relational Databases (RDBMS)**: Gain a solid understanding of how data is structured and managed.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/introduction-to-relational-databases)

5. **SQL: A Practical Introduction for Querying Databases**: Learn SQL, the powerful language used to manage and query databases.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/sql-practical-introduction-for-querying-databases)

6. **Getting Started with Data Warehousing and BI Analytics**: Kickstart your journey in data warehousing and BI analytics.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/getting-started-with-data-warehousing-and-bi-analytics)

7. **Statistics Fundamentals Using Excel**: Familiarize yourself with basic statistical concepts and methods.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/statistics-fundamentals-using-excel)

8. **Getting Started with Tableau**: Unlock the potential of Tableau Public for data visualization.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/getting-started-with-tableau)

9. **Advanced Data Visualization with Tableau**: Enhance your analytics and data visualization skills with advanced techniques.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/advanced-data-visualization-with-tableau)

10. **BI Analyst Capstone**: Culminate your learning with a capstone project that showcases your BI skills. [Learn more](https://www.coursera.org/learn/bi-analyst-capstone)
